Replacing Sliding Closet Doors with Bifold Doors: A Comprehensive Guide
When it pertains to optimizing space and enhancing the aesthetic appeal of a space, changing sliding closet doors with bifold doors can be a game-changer. Bifold doors provide an unique solution that not just saves space but likewise includes a modern touch to any interior. This post will guide you through the procedure of changing sliding closet doors with bifold doors, covering whatever from the benefits to the step-by-step setup procedure.
Intro
Closet doors are a crucial part of any space, serving both practical and aesthetic functions. While sliding closet doors have been a popular option for years, they come with their own set of constraints, such as minimal space utilization and a less modern-day look. Bifold doors, on the other hand, offer a more flexible and stylish option. By folding nicely to the side, bifold doors can open the closet area completely, making it simpler to access all items and producing a more open and airy feel in the room.

Before you start the installation process, it's crucial to pick the ideal bifold doors for your closet. Consider the following aspects:
Size: Measure the width and height of your closet opening to ensure the doors fit completely.Product: Bifold doors are offered in different products, consisting of wood, MDF, and glass. Select a material that matches your space's design and toughness needs.Complete: Select a surface that matches your existing decoration, such as painted, stained, or natural wood.Hardware: High-quality hardware is important for the smooth operation of bifold doors. Eliminate the Existing Sliding Doors
Use a screwdriver to remove the screws holding the sliding doors to the track.Carefully raise the doors out of the track and set them aside.
Prepare the Closet Opening
Clean the closet opening to ensure it is without any debris or old hardware.Examine the opening for level and plumb using a level. Make any essential adjustments to guarantee the doors will hang straight.
Install the Hinges
Mark the positions for the depend upon the door frame using a pencil. Make sure the marks are level and equally spaced.Drill pilot holes for the screws.Connect the hinges to the door frame utilizing the screws provided.
Attach the Doors to the Hinges
Thoroughly line up the bifold doors with the hinges.Connect the doors to the hinges utilizing the screws provided. Ensure the doors are securely fastened and hang uniformly.
Adjust the Doors
Open and close the doors to ensure they run smoothly.Make any required adjustments to the hinges to guarantee the doors hang straight and close correctly.
Completing Touches
If required, paint or stain the doors to match your space's decor.Install any extra hardware, such as handles or locks, to complete the look.Frequently asked questions
Q: Are bifold doors difficult to install?A: Bifold doors are normally easier to install than sliding doors. With the right tools and a little perseverance, most DIY lovers can complete the installation in a few hours.

Q: Can I install bifold doors on an existing closet frame?A: Yes, bifold doors can be installed on an existing closet frame. Nevertheless, you might need to make some modifications to guarantee the doors fit properly and operate efficiently.

Q: How do I select the right size for bifold doors?A: Measure the width and height of your closet opening. Bifold doors ought to be slightly smaller sized than the opening to guarantee they fit without binding or rubbing.

Q: Can I utilize bifold doors in a small closet?A: Absolutely! Bifold doors are particularly appropriate for small closets as they take up minimal area when opened, making the most of the readily available floor area.

Q: How do I maintain bifold doors?A: Regularly clean the doors and hardware to prevent dust and dirt accumulation. Lube the hinges occasionally to ensure smooth operation. If the doors become misaligned, make modifications to the hinges as required.
